Sue Fagan
January 24, 1938 - January 21, 2021

Mrs. Cora Sue “Susie” Fagan of Trumann departed this life on Thursday, January 21, 2021 at Three Rivers Nursing and Rehab in Marked Tree, AR at the age of 82 years, 11 months and 28 days.  She was born Monday, January 24, 1938 in Belmont, Mississippi to the late Otho and Hazel Taylor Vinson and lived most of her lifetime in Trumann.  Sue was retired from Salant & Salant in Marked Tree.  She was preceded in death by two brothers, James Vinson and Carroll Vinson; three sisters, Billie Jean Killian, Willa Presley, and Fredia Vick; and her parents.       She is survived by her husband of 63 years, Billy Fagan of the home; one son, Mark (Becky) Fagan of Trumann; one daughter, Tammie Mabe of Trumann, one sister, Linda Welch of Proctor,  three grandchildren, Matthew (Courtney) Mabe of Trumann, Mikka (Tyler) Brooks of Trumann and Nicole (Ryan) Bane of Jonesboro; and six great-grandchildren, Madison Brown, Asher Cole Mabe, Preslee Bane, Bonham Bane, Rae Leigh Brooks and Conner Bane.         Visitation will be Saturday from 10:00 to 11:00 a.m. at Thompson Funeral Home in Trumann.  A Celebration of Life will follow at 11:00 a.m. in the chapel of Thompson Funeral Home with Rev.  Ricky Forbis officiating.  Burial will follow in Jonesboro Memorial Park Cemetery in Jonesboro.       Pallbearers will be Junior Chaffin, Tim Halfacre, Mike Bell, Richard Holt, Joey Fagan and Matthew Mabe.   In compliance with COVID-19 guidelines, social distancing will be required along with face masks and the signing of a COVID-19 form.         An online register book can be signed at www.thompsonfuneralhome.net.
